There is trout fishing in the Urubamba River, which flows past the towns of Ollantaytambo, Piscac, and eventually Macchu Pichu. The Angling Report (see their web site) had a recent article with info on contacting a local guide who operates out of Cusco.

Be advised, however, that April is the end of the rainy season and the Urubamba will probably be high and unfishable. Perhaps guides may be able to provide other options.
